To install a sink without creating leaks or cabinet damage, treat the job as three connected tasks: support the fixture correctly, build the drain so it aligns without strain, and make watertight water-supply connections. The exact hardware differs between a kitchen, bathroom, drop-in, undermount, pedestal, or vessel sink, but the order of work matters in every case. Dry-fit the parts first, tighten only where seals are correctly seated, and test the installation under both standing-water and flowing-water conditions before closing the cabinet or using the sink normally.
The first decision is not which wrench to use; it is whether the sink, countertop, and plumbing arrangement are compatible. A replacement is usually straightforward when the new fixture matches the existing cutout and drain position. Changing from one installation style to another can involve countertop work, cabinet modification, or moving drain and supply piping.
| Sink type | How it is supported | Best suited to | Key installation concern |
|---|---|---|---|
| Drop-in or self-rimming | Rim rests on countertop; clips may secure it below | Many kitchen and bathroom countertop replacements | Seal the rim evenly and do not overtighten clips |
| Undermount | Mounted beneath the countertop with specified anchors or brackets | Solid-surface, stone, or compatible composite countertops | Mounting must support the sink’s loaded weight, not just its empty weight |
| Pedestal bathroom sink | Wall fasteners support the basin; pedestal mainly conceals plumbing | Small bathrooms where open floor space matters | Wall framing and mounting hardware must carry the basin |
| Vessel sink | Sits on top of a vanity or counter | Vanities designed for above-counter basins | Faucet height, spout reach, and drain compatibility are critical |
| Wall-mounted sink | Wall carrier or structural blocking supports the fixture | Bathrooms where clear floor space is desired | Do not rely on drywall anchors for a heavy basin |
A like-for-like drop-in replacement is generally the most manageable homeowner project. An undermount sink can look clean and makes wiping a counter easier, but it demands a dependable support system and a properly sealed countertop edge. If the countertop is cracked, the cutout is too large, the sink is unusually heavy, or wall support is uncertain, it is safer to bring in a qualified plumber or countertop installer.
Read the installation instructions that came with the sink, faucet, drain assembly, and garbage disposer, if one is being retained or added. Manufacturers may specify particular clips, brackets, sealants, or tightening limits. Do not assume that old hardware will fit the new fixture.
Replace visibly corroded shutoff valves, brittle supply connectors, damaged trap parts, and flattened washers rather than trying to reuse them. Old parts may hold temporarily and then fail when they are disturbed during the sink installation.
Open the cabinet and identify the hot-water valve, cold-water valve, drain stub-out, and any branch connections for a dishwasher or disposer. Check for swollen cabinet flooring, staining, corrosion, or a persistent sewer odor. These are signs that a prior leak or venting problem may need attention before a new sink hides it.
Measure the new sink’s bowl depth against the available space below. Deep kitchen bowls can leave less room for the drain tailpiece and P-trap. In a bathroom vanity, drawers or shelves may interfere with the trap. A sink can physically fit the countertop while still creating an impractical drain layout.
If the wall drain is far too high for the new bowl, or the trap must be assembled with sharp bends and extensions to reach it, stop before installation. Correcting the drain height or location is a plumbing alteration, not a detail to solve with excessive flexible piping.

A sink drain needs a trap to hold water and block sewer gases from entering the room. The trap must also be positioned so it can be removed for cleaning or repair. The goal is a direct, supported path from the sink tailpiece through the P-trap and into the wall drain, without sagging extensions or tightly stressed joints.
Dry-fitting is especially important under deep kitchen sinks. If you add a garbage disposer, dishwasher branch tailpiece, or second bowl connection, the arrangement becomes more complex. Follow the disposer instructions, support the unit correctly, and ensure the dishwasher drain setup meets the requirements that apply in your area. A high loop or air-gap arrangement may be required depending on local rules and the appliance installation instructions.
Modern braided supply connectors are common for sink faucets because they simplify alignment, but they still need to be installed without twisting, kinking, or excessive bending. Select connectors that reach comfortably from the shutoff valves to the faucet inlets. A connector stretched tight or coiled into a sharp bend can be difficult to inspect and may not seal well.
Use the shutoff valves only if they operate smoothly and fully stop the water. If a valve is seized, heavily corroded, or leaks around its stem when operated, replacing it may be wiser than connecting a new sink to questionable hardware. That work can require shutting off water to a larger part of the home and is a reasonable point to call a plumber.
| Where water appears | Likely source | First check | Appropriate response |
|---|---|---|---|
| At faucet supply connection | Loose or cross-threaded connector | Dry the fitting and watch while water is on | Turn water off, reconnect by hand, then tighten carefully |
| Below drain flange | Failed seal at basket or pop-up drain | Fill bowl and inspect before opening drain | Remove and reseal the drain assembly if needed |
| At slip-joint nut | Misaligned pipe or reversed/damaged washer | Check that pipes enter straight | Re-seat washer and realign parts; do not simply tighten harder |
| At wall drain | Trap arm not seated properly or wall fitting issue | Inspect joint during a fast drain test | Adjust the trap arm; seek help if the wall fitting is damaged |
| On cabinet floor with no obvious active drip | Intermittent leak, condensation, or old damage | Use dry paper towel around every connection during testing | Identify the source before storing items in the cabinet |
Do not respond to a leak by repeatedly tightening every nut. Compression and slip-joint connections seal because their components are seated correctly, not because they have been forced as tight as possible. Disassemble, inspect, realign, and replace the relevant washer or connector when necessary.
Many homeowners can install a sink that replaces an existing, compatible fixture. The project becomes less suitable for DIY work when it affects structural support, concealed plumbing, countertop fabrication, or electrical equipment. Saving time at the start is not worthwhile if a poor installation risks water damage inside a cabinet, wall, or ceiling.

A professional is also a sensible choice for a sink made from a heavy or fragile material. The mounting process may require more than one person, carefully selected hardware, and protection of the countertop edge during handling.
Use the material specified by the drain and sink manufacturers. Plumber’s putty is commonly used beneath certain drain flanges, while some materials or finishes require silicone or another approved sealant. Avoid using a product that could stain, damage, or fail to adhere to the sink material.
You can reuse a trap that is clean, undamaged, and still aligns naturally with the new drain outlet. Replace it if the threads are worn, the plastic is brittle, metal parts are corroded, or the new sink requires an awkward arrangement. New washers are often worthwhile even when the trap itself remains usable.
Start all threaded connections by hand. Slip-joint nuts and many supply fittings should be snug enough to seal without deforming washers or damaging threads; the exact tightening method depends on the fitting type. If a connection leaks, inspect alignment and sealing surfaces rather than applying excessive force.

The safest way to install a sink is to avoid rushing the hidden work beneath it. Make sure the fixture is properly supported, the drain has a relaxed and serviceable path to the wall connection, and the supply lines are correctly seated. Then test with both pressurized water and a filled basin before returning cleaners, bins, or stored items to the cabinet. A careful final inspection is the small step most likely to prevent a minor installation error from becoming costly water damage.
